Urine Drug Test OverviewUrine drug tests are a widely-used method for detecting the presence of drugs in the body. Ideal for a variety of testing situations, they offer a non-invasive, cost-effective solution. Urine tests are prevalent in employment settings, fulfilling regulatory needs and ensuring workplace safety. Results are typically rapid, with negative results processed in 24 hours, while positives may take longer to confirm.
Why Choose A Urine Drug Test?Choosing a urine drug test is advantageous for its efficiency and affordability. Its reliability in detecting recent drug use makes it the standard in many industries. The non-invasive nature of the test further adds to its practicality.
Who Needs a Urine Drug Test?Urine drug tests are often necessary for job seekers as part of the hiring process or for current employees under employer policies. Legal requirements, such as probationary checks, frequently use this modality for compliance purposes.
Hair Follicle Drug Test in Garden City, MI: Overview
Hair follicle drug testing is a comprehensive method capable of detecting drug use history over an extended period. In Garden City, MI, this approach is often used for thorough background checks and legal screenings. Although results take longer, the ability to provide a long-term substance use overview is unmatched, making it a valuable tool for employers and legal authorities.
Why Choose A Hair Follicle Drug Test?
- Non-invasive collection procedure
- Can detect substances used up to 90 days prior
- Ideal for identifying chronic substance use
Who Needs a Hair Follicle Drug Test?
- Employers conducting in-depth background checks
- Legal entities requiring comprehensive drug use history
- Rehabilitation centers monitoring prolonged sobriety
Basic outline: Oral fluid drug tests in Garden City, MI are increasingly popular due to their simplicity and quick turnaround time. Unlike other methods, oral fluid tests detect recent drug use, typically within the past 24-48 hours, making them ideal for post-incident reports or rapid screenings. This method involves collecting saliva samples, which are then analyzed to uncover recent substance intake. Results from oral fluid testing can be as swift as 24 hours for negatives and 1-3 days for positives, ensuring timely decision-making for employers, schools, or law enforcement when immediate actions might be necessary.
Why Choose An Oral Fluid Drug Test: Oral fluid tests are easy to administer, minimize the risk of tampering, and deliver quick results, ideal for situations requiring immediate screening information.
Who Needs an Oral Fluid Drug Test: Employers and authorities seeking immediate detection of recent substance use often choose oral fluid tests for their convenience and rapid results.
Basic Outline: Blood drug tests in Garden City, MI are used to ascertain current intoxication levels by detecting drugs and their metabolites within the bloodstream. Due to its invasive nature, blood testing is less common for regular screening but is invaluable in specific situations requiring precise measurements. It is a reliable indicator of current levels of impairment, catering chiefly to medical or legal contexts. Testing requires a trained professional to draw the sample, often in a clinical setting. Results from blood tests offer high accuracy, providing insights into the exact concentration of substances at the point of collection. Processing times for these tests are longer owing to the need for detailed analysis, usually taking a week or more.
Why Choose A Blood Drug Test? This method provides precise concentration readings of drugs in the bloodstream, making it ideal for scenarios where knowing the exact level of intoxication is crucial. It's particularly valuable in medical emergencies or legal situations where impairment confirmation is required.
Who Needs a Blood Drug Test? Blood drug tests are predominantly used for individuals thought to be currently impaired, such as in DUI cases. They are also employed in medical settings where drug level monitoring is necessary for treatment planning or overdose assessment.
The 5-panel drug test in Garden City, MI is the most basic drug screening method, detecting five common substances: marijuana, cocaine, opiates, amphetamines, and PCP. It's typically employed for standard workplace and pre-employment testing.

10 Panel Test in Garden City, MI
The 10-panel test increases the scope of drug detection, including substances from the 5-panel and additional elements. It screens for ten different drugs, among them barbiturates, benzodiazepines, and methadone.
